Dual-frequency LVDS clock in a 14-SMD footprint
It operates from a single 2.25V to 3.6V supply, drawing 32mA max, and fits a 3.20mm x 2.50mm 14-SMD no-lead package — a common footprint for high-speed clock modules.
It suits indoor networking gear, test equipment, and office electronics, but not outdoor base stations or engine-bay modules where -40°C or +85°C is needed. Frequency stability is ±50ppm over that range — enough for most Ethernet and FPGA reference clocks, though a tighter ±25ppm part would be chosen for precision timing like SyncE.
